'Trifecta' of Blessings

 The Most Holy Trinity
~~~ Deuteronomy 4:32-34, 39-40 ~~~ Psalm 33 ~~~
~~~Romans 8:14-17 ~~~ Matthew 28:16-20 ~~~

Glory to the Father, the Son, and the Holy Spirit;
to God who is, who was, and who is to come.

In horse racing there is a type of bet called a trifecta.
For this bet you must correctly pick the first three winners.
Not only must the winners be selected,
but they must be in the correct order.

God gave us the three persons...
Father, Son, and Holy Spirit.
There is no need consider any other gods.
There is no need to bet on the top three.

Our doctrine teaches that the Trinity
is the description of God...
three persons in one.
Belief in the Trinity is the very root of the Catholic faith.
We profess it each time we pray the Creed.
We Baptize in the name of the Father,
 the Son, and the Holy Spirit.
We begin most of our prayers
by marking ourselves with the sign of the cross
calling to mind the three persons.

Belief in the Trinity...
“The mystery of the Most Holy Trinity is the central mystery
 of Christian faith and life” (CCC 234)

There is only One God.
He sends us a 'trifecta' of Blessings.
In the name of the Father, Son, and Holy Spirit.

If we could understand our triune God,
Saint Augustine says...he would not be God.
